Transaction 26673edaf529a8a50c499fa3329bb285a9eec482b11631059c8a5d3814b3eb9d

1 Input
2 Outputs
  • 26673edaf529a8a50c499fa3329bb285a9eec482b11631059c8a5d3814b3eb9d:0
  • value  500000000
    address  35aWvzthJD3Y3RiYWb6gLFvka4dNa1FxW5
  • 26673edaf529a8a50c499fa3329bb285a9eec482b11631059c8a5d3814b3eb9d:1
  • value  22944498
    address  1N9uPyRvoR26AaFesMdRsDtmS3FyCKQ7ZT